episode 14: Ep.14 Hoping to be wrong


Tip offs for a story can come in many forms, but for Alistair one investigation he worked on started in the worst way imaginable: with the death of a loved one.


From a hospital car-park in the Midlands to a meeting with the Health Secretary, the BBC’s Alistair Jackson sets off to explore sepsis deaths in the UK.
